Limbali - Sojitra, Anand

Limbali is a village situated in the Sojitra taluka of Anand district, Gujarat. It is located approximately 2 km from the tehsil headquarters in Sojitra and around 28 km from the district headquarters in Anand. Limbali village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Limbali is 516859. The village covers a total geographical area of 329.76 hectares and falls under the 387240 pincode. Sojitra is the nearest town, located about 2 km away.

Limbali village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Sojitra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Anand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Limbali

As per Census 2011, Limbali village has a total population of 1,702 people, consisting of 900 males and 802 females. The village has 339 households and a sex ratio of 891 females per 1,000 males. There are 237 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 1,077 literate and 625 illiterate residents. Additionally, 55 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 7 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Limbali

Limbali is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is located within 2-5 km of Limbali.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Sojitra to Limbali is about 2 km, with a usual travel time of around 5-10 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Anand to Limbali is about 28 km, with the usual travel time around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
